Palouse Capital Management Inc. decreased its position in shares of Lamar Advertising (NASDAQ:LAMR – Free Report) by 2.0% in the 4th qu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The firm owned 35,746 shares of the real estate investment trust’s stock after selling 725 shares during the quarter. Lamar Advertising makes up 2.7% of Palouse Capital Management Inc.’s investment portfolio, making the stock its 9th largest position. Palouse Capital Management Inc.’s holdings in Lamar Advertising were worth $3,799,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Lamar Advertising Increases Dividend
The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, March 28th. Shareholders of record on Friday, March 15th were paid a $1.30 dividend. This is a boost from Lamar Advertising’s previous quarterly dividend of $1.25. This represents a $5.20 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 4.67%. The ex-dividend date was Thursday, March 14th. Lamar Advertising’s payout ratio is 107.22%.

Lamar Advertising Profile
Lamar Advertising Company operates as an outdoor advertising company in the United States and Canada. The company owns and operates billboards, logo signs, and transit advertising displays, as well as rents space for advertising on billboards, buses, shelters, benches, logo plates, and in airport terminals.
